Summary

Harrison Township in Montgomery County has launched a new firefighter apprenticeship program aimed at training the next generation of firefighters. This initiative reflects a commitment to workforce development in the region.

Why this matters for apprenticeships

This new apprenticeship program is significant as it contributes to the growth of skilled labor in the firefighting sector, addressing workforce shortages while providing valuable training opportunities for apprentices. Such programs enhance career pathways and support community safety.
